    Goals: 25. Burgstaller (Danso), 76. Arnautović (Burgstaller), 89. Schaub (Bauer) – 11. Milivojević, 83. N. Matić

    Cards:   43. Wöber (AUT), 44. Ilsanker (AUT), 55. Burgstaller (AUT), 70. Bauer (AUT), 90+2. Dragović (AUT)


    Ball possession: 52 % : 48 %.
    Shots on target: 8:4. Shots off target: 8:3. Corners: 8:1. Offsides: 2:3. Fouls: 16:8.
    Austria: Lindner – Bauer, Dragović, Danso, Wöber – Grillitsch (77. Lazaro), Baumgartlinger (C), Ilsanker, Arnautović – Kainz (61. Schaub) – Burgstaller (82. Gregoritsch).
    Subs: Bachmann, Pervan – Gregoritsch, Janko, Klein, Lainer, Lazaro, Lienhart, Schaub, Knasmüllner, Schobesberger, H. Wolf.

    Serbia: Stojković – Ivanović (C), S. Mitrović, Nastasić – Antonio Rukavina (69. Ljajić), Milivojević, N. Matić, Kolarov – Gaćinović (87. Prijović), Tadić – A. Mitrović.
    Subs: Jovanović – Gudelj, Kostić, Ljajić, Nemanja Maksimović, Obradović, Pavlović, Prijović, S. Rajković, D. Tošić, N. Milunović, Veljković.

    Referees: Královec – Slyško, Nádvorník
